VONSCH has long been aware of the fact that the majority of converter applications are simple, not taking the advantage of various hardware and software advanced features offered, making the purchase aimlessly expensive. Therefore, VONSCH has developed special converter solution for not high-demanding applications. An innovation of cost effective solution has resulted in E (Economy) series of maximally reliable and quality frequency converters fulfilling customer’s requirements at an unbeatable price. VQFREM 400 E and VQFREM 230 E frequency converter series have been designed to modify successful VQFREM 400 M series into economic version with fewer features. VQFREM 400 E/ 230 E frequency converter series basically do not include RS 485/ 232 interface, do not include braking module, vector control is not supported. User interface has been reduced to simple LED display and a three-button keypad. VQFREM 400 E / 230E primary benefits from its features:

General technical data

Input voltage: VQFREM 400E: 3 x 400 VAC ± 10 % 47 - 63 Hz
VQFREM 400 001/230E: 1 x 230 VAC ± 10 % 47 - 63 Hz
Cooling:VQFREM 400E, 400 001/230E: 0,37 ÷ 0,75 ambient air cooling, converters of higher power ranges - integrated fan cooling
Output frequency range:0 Hz ÷ 99,9 Hz
Control system:32 bit. Texas Instruments DSP; Space vector PWM modulation strategy
Analogue inputs:0 ÷ 20 mA (165 Ω), 4 - 20 mA (165 Ω), 0 - 10 V, 2 - 10 V, potentiometer, motor potentiometer; output voltage + 10 V (short circuit protection) max. 10 mA. Potentiometer 1 kΩ to 10 kΩ
Control inputs and interface: 4 binary inputs (for multi-level speed selection, or for remote motor potentiometer, reverse, reset, fault confirmation), active level: 0 V
Motor torque: to 150 % Mn during the period of 60 s
Ramp up and ramp down time: adjustable acceleration and deceleration times within 0,1 ÷ 99,9 s range, time ramps with break points, S curve
Electronic protection against: overcurrent, overvoltage, undervoltage, short circuit protection, ground fault protection, converter overheating, motor overheating (thermal integral I2t)
Maximum altitude: < 1000 m above sea level, each 100 m above 1000 m above sea level causes decrease of converters power by 1 %
Relative air humidity: < 80 % non-condensing, dewing not permissible
Permissible ambient temperature during operation: + 1 °C až + 40 °C
